Output 8630859de58b09328a24918399d7e17b724903fe23344817e379213cf27d0b52:0

value
12364340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5616f0f968d1094ff27b8b010d8a9c0336514c3 OP_EQUAL
address
3Kgfm9yriSe3RWPrShuiw1buHXf3nvQqt3
transaction
8630859de58b09328a24918399d7e17b724903fe23344817e379213cf27d0b52
spent
true